      1.) Many people (dream scientists included) thought Lucid Dreaming did not exist. This has now been proven wrong by having a lucid dreamer communicate with scientists via eye movement.
      2.) The 'Pinch me I'm dreaming' reality check. Testing your state by pinching yourself in a dream is NOT an effective RC. You mind can still produce a simulation of the feeling of pain without an external stimulus.
